New Hampshire HB 64 (2025) — relative to extending hiring preferences for military members and their spouses to the state and private businesses, and establishing purchase preferences for disabled veterans and military spouses regarding state supply purchases.

Timeline
The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.
- 2024-12-23 Introduced 01/08/2025 and referred to State-Federal Relations and Veterans Affairs HJ 2 P. 4
introduction, referral-committee - 2025-01-15 Public Hearing: 01/24/2025 10:10 am LOB 206-208
- 2025-01-22 Executive Session: 01/31/2025 01:30 pm LOB 206-208
- 2025-02-04 Committee Report: Ought to Pass 01/31/2025 (Vote 18-0; RC) HC 11 P. 13
committee-passage-favorable - 2025-02-13 Ought to Pass: MA VV 02/13/2025 HJ 5 P. 33
committee-passage-favorable, passage - 2025-03-12 Introduced 03/06/2025 and Referred to Executive Departments and Administration; SJ 7
introduction, referral-committee - 2025-03-19 Hearing: 03/26/2025, Room 103, SH, 09:45 am; SC 14
- 2025-04-17 Committee Amendment # 2025-1478s, AA, VV; 04/17/2025; SJ 10
- 2025-04-17 Ought to Pass with Amendment #2025-1478s, MA, VV; OT3rdg; 04/17/2025; SJ 10
committee-passage-favorable, passage - 2025-04-09 Committee Report: Ought to Pass with Amendment # 2025-1478s, 04/17/2025; Vote 5-0; CC; SC 17
committee-passage-favorable - 2025-05-08 House Concurs with Senate Amendment 2025-1478s (Rep. Moffett): MA VV 05/08/2025 HJ 14 P. 4
- 2025-06-16 Enrolled Adopted, VV, (In recess 06/12/2025); SJ 17
enrolled - 2025-06-16 Enrolled (in recess of) 06/12/2025 HJ 17 P. 24
- 2025-06-25 Signed by Governor Ayotte 06/23/2025; Chapter 107; eff. 08/22/2025
